Question 3 of 5

A 30-year-old woman with a BMI of 36 is being counseled on weight reduction. In what order should interventions be discussed?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: The nurse should start with a full assessment (lipid profile and blood pressure), followed by education on diet and exercise, then medication, and finally surgery if needed.

Question 5 of 5

During a well-child visit, a parent tells the nurse that their preschooler occasionally wakes up during the middle of the night. Based on growth and development, which of the following would be the most common reason for the preschooler to wake up?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: Nightmares are common in preschoolers and often cause nighttime awakenings.
